Coronary embolism (CE) is an uncommon and unique cause of acute myocardial infarction. In this report, we review 216 cases of CE including 2 new cases from our institution. The mean patient age was 52.5 years and 62% of the patients were males. Chest pain was the most common presenting symptom followed by dyspnea, and the most commonly affected vessel was the left anterior descending artery. Leading etiologies of the embolus were atrial fibrillation, septic emboli, and iatrogenic causes. Treatment approaches varied with thrombus aspiration being used in 30% of cases. In-hospital mortality rate was 36% and 13% of the cases were complicated by cerebrovascular accident. CE is a unique pathology that leads to acute myocardial infarction. It portends a high mortality rate and requires a high level of suspicion as symptoms may be misleading. Further research is needed in order to improve recognition and management and to lower associated mortality.  相似文献

A role of insular cortex in cardiovascular function   总被引:5,自引:0,他引:5  
We sought to determine whether the insular cortex contributes to the regulation of arterial blood pressure (AP). Responses to electrical and chemical stimulation of the cortex were studied in the anesthetized, paralyzed, and artificially ventilated Sprague-Dawley rat. The insular cortex was initially defined, anatomically, by the distributions of retrogradely labeled perikarya following injections of wheat germ agglutinin-horseradish peroxidase (WGA-HRP) into the nucleus tractus solitarii (NTS). Injections of WGA-HRP into the insular cortex anterogradely labeled terminals in cardiopulmonary and other divisions of the NTS and confirmed projections revealed by retrograde tracing experiments. Electrical stimulation of the insular cortex elicited elevations of AP (less than or equal to 50 mm Hg) and cardioacceleration (less than or equal to 40 bpm). The locations of the most active pressor sites corresponded closely to the locations of retrogradely labeled cells in layer V of granular and posterior agranular areas of the insular cortex (areas 14 and 13) and the extreme capsule. Maximal pressor responses were obtained at a stimulus intensity of three to five times threshold current of 20-30 microA. Responses elicited mostly with higher-threshold currents were also mapped in areas 2a and 5lb and the claustrum and within the corpus callosum. Unilateral injections into the insular pressor area of the excitatory amino acid monosodium glutamate (L-Glu; 0.05 nmol to 10 nmol) or the rigid structural analogue of L-Glu, kainic acid (KA) (0.4 nmol) (which specifically excite perikarya), caused topographically specific elevations in AP and tachycardia. During the course of the anatomical transport studies, new findings were obtained on the organization and characteristics of the cortical innervation of the NTS and the nucleus reticularis parvocellularis. Topographic relationships between the cortex and the NTS were organized in a more complex manner than previously thought. Cells projecting to caudal cardiopulmonary segments of the NTS were fewer and generally located ventrally and caudally and in a more restricted area than cells projecting rostrally or to the parvicellular reticular formation. Anterograde transport data revealed new presumptive terminal fields in dorsolateral, ventral, periventricular, and commissural regions of the NTS, including an area overlapping the terminal field of the aortic baroreceptor nerve. We conclude that neurons within an area of the insular cortex projecting to multiple brainstem autonomic nuclei, including a region of the NTS innervated by baroreceptor afferents, increase arterial blood pressure and heart rate.(ABSTRACT TRUNCATED AT 400 WORDS)  相似文献

OBJECTIVE: The aim of this study was to investigate and analyze the angulation of and the various indications for removal of mandibular third molars in Jordanians as a representative Arab sample. METHOD AND MATERIALS: The data included in this retrospective study were obtained from the clinical and radiographic records of 1,282 patients undergoing mandibular third molar surgery during a 5-year period from 1994 to 1999. The indications for removal of the mandibular third molars were classified in accordance with age and gender. The angular position of mandibular third molars was registered. RESULTS: A total of 2,252 mandibular third molars were removed from 740 male patients (57.7%) and 542 female patients (42.3%) aged 14 to 67 years. Pericoronitis was the most common indication for surgery, affecting 1,055 teeth (46.8%). Caries was observed in 519 third molars (23.0%). The vertical angular position was most commonly found (1,383 teeth; 61.4%) followed by the mesioangular position (407 teeth; 18.1%). CONCLUSION: The results obtained in this study are similar to those reported in earlier studies carried out elsewhere, although the incidence of periodontitis among Jordanians was significantly higher and occurred in older patients, and prophylactic removal was performed less frequently than has been reported in other countries.  相似文献

Background: Methicillin‐resistant Staphylococcus aureus (MRSA) infections continue to increase in UK hospitals despite the introduction of various control measures. These infections have serious clinical and economic implications, particularly in relation to elective orthopaedic surgery. Methods: A prospective study was performed from August 2003 to July 2004 to assess the effect of preadmission screening and ‘ring fencing’ of beds on the incidence of infection in an elective orthopaedics unit. Results: The preoperative incidence of MRSA colonization was 2.25% and 53% of these patients had at least one risk factor. There were no postoperative MRSA infections in the ring‐fenced orthopaedic unit. Conclusions: Preoperative screening and ring fencing reduced the MRSA incidence to zero in the operated patients. Mechanisms need to be developed where screening and isolation of MRSA cases can be performed in most, if not all, hospital admissions.  相似文献

Background: For nitrous oxide, a preconditioning effect on the heart has yet not been investigated. This is important because nitrous oxide is commonly used in combination with volatile anesthetics, which are known to precondition the heart. The authors aimed to clarify (1) whether nitrous oxide preconditions the heart, (2) how it affects protein kinase C (PKC) and tyrosine kinases (such as Src) as central mediators of preconditioning, and (3) whether isoflurane-induced preconditioning is influenced by nitrous oxide.

Methods: For infarct size measurements, anesthetized rats were subjected to 25 min of coronary artery occlusion followed by 120 min of reperfusion. Rats received nitrous oxide (60%), isoflurane (1.4%) or isoflurane-nitrous oxide (1.4%/60%) during three 5-min periods before index ischemia (each group, n = 7). Control animals remained untreated for 45 min. Additional hearts (control, 60% nitrous oxide alone%, and isoflurane-nitrous oxide [0.6%/60%, in equianesthetic doses]) were excised for Western blot of PKC-[varepsilon] and Src kinase (each group, n = 4).

Results: Nitrous oxide had no effect on infarct size (59.1 +/- 15.2% of the area at risk vs. 51.1 +/- 10.9% in controls). Isoflurane (1.4%) and isoflurane-nitrous oxide (1.4%/60%) reduced infarct size to 30.9 +/- 10.6 and 28.7 +/- 11.8% (both P < 0.01). Nitrous oxide (60%) had no effect on phosphorylation (2.3 +/- 1.8 vs. 2.5 +/- 1.7 in controls, average light intensity, arbitrary units) and translocation (7.0 +/- 4.3 vs. 7.4 +/- 5.2 in controls) of PKC-[varepsilon]. Src kinase phosphorylation was not influenced by nitrous oxide (4.6 +/- 3.9 vs. 5.0 +/- 3.8; 3.2 +/- 2.2 vs. 3.5 +/- 3.0). Isoflurane-nitrous oxide (0.6%/60%, in equianesthetic doses) induced PKC-[varepsilon] phosphorylation (5.4 +/- 1.9 vs. 2.8 +/- 1.5; P < 0.001) and translocation to membrane regions (13.8 +/- 13.0 vs. 6.7 +/- 2.0 in controls; P < 0.05).  相似文献

BACKGROUND: The addition of short course pre-operative radiotherapy to total mesorectal excision reduces local recurrence in resectable adenocarcinoma of the rectum. In a previous retrospective study potential factors associated with early complications following this combination were identified. The aim of this study was to examine these relationships in a prospective multicentre audit. METHODS: One hundred and seven patients who received short course pre-operative radiotherapy in four cancer centres between 1 October 2001 and 30 September 2002 were included. Data including patient age, radiotherapy field length, overall treatment time, operation type, surgical outcomes and complications occurring within 3 months of the 1st day of radiotherapy were collected. These were compared and combined with the previously studied cohort of 176 patients treated at one centre between 1st January 1998 and 31st December 1999. RESULTS: In the prospective cohort only patient age (P=0.001) was significantly associated with acute complications. However, both the overall treatment time (median 9.0 vs 11.0 days P <0.0001) and field length (median 16.6 vs 17.0 cm P=0.03) were significantly shorter in this cohort when compared to the previous retrospective study. In patients from both studies (n=283), increasing age (P=0.002) and field length (independent of operation type) (P=0.02) were independently associated with an increased risk of acute complications. CONCLUSIONS: This study suggests that meticulous selection of patients for short course pre-operative radiotherapy and smaller planning target volumes may be associated with a lower risk of acute complications. The use of MRI scanning to stage pelvic disease may reduce the number of patients with R1 resections receiving short course pre-operative radiotherapy.  相似文献
